  1. Perform routine maintenance tasks, including but not limited to, inspecting, cleaning, lubricating, and repairing equipment and machinery to ensure proper functioning and longevity.
  2. Troubleshoot and diagnose mechanical issues with equipment and facilities, and develop effective solutions to address them.
  3. Conduct preventative maintenance on equipment and facilities, following established schedules and procedures to minimize downtime and prevent costly repairs.
  4. Respond to maintenance requests and emergencies in a timely and efficient manner, ensuring the safety and comfort of patients and staff.
  5. Maintain accurate records of all maintenance activities, including repairs, replacements, and inspections, and report any major issues or concerns to management.
  6. Collaborate with other maintenance team members to complete projects and tasks, and provide guidance and training to junior mechanics.
  7. Monitor inventory levels of equipment parts and supplies, and notify management of any shortages or needs.
  8. Adhere to all safety protocols and regulations when performing maintenance tasks, and identify and address potential safety hazards.
  9. Stay current on industry developments and best practices in maintenance and repair, and make recommendations for improvements to facilities and equipment.
  10. Represent the organization in a professional manner, demonstrating a commitment to outstanding customer service and quality work.
  11. Maintain a clean and organized work environment, and properly use and maintain tools and equipment.

Job Qualifications
  • Minimum Of 5 Years Of Experience In A Maintenance Mechanic Role, With A Strong Understanding Of Mechanical, Electrical, And Hvac Systems.

  • High School Diploma Or Equivalent Education, With Additional Technical Training Or Certifications Preferred.

  • Ability To Read And Interpret Technical Manuals, Blueprints, And Schematics.

  • Strong Troubleshooting And Problem-Solving Skills, With The Ability To Identify And Resolve Complex Maintenance Issues.

  • Strong Communication And Interpersonal Skills, With The Ability To Work Effectively As Part Of A Team And Communicate With Various Stakeholders.

About Atrium Health

Atrium Health, formerly Carolinas HealthCare System, is a not for profit hospital network which operates hospitals, freestanding emergency departments, urgent care centers, and medical practices in the American states of North Carolina, South Carolina and Georgia.
